Reed Business Information Acquires Ascend, a Leading Provider of Data, Analytics and Advisory Services to the Global Aviation Industry
Dépèche transmise le 30 juin 2011 par PRNewswire
SUTTON, England, June 30, 2011 /PRNewswire/ --
Reed Business Information ("RBI"), the business information division of Reed Elsevier, announced today that it has acquired the entire issued share capital of Ascend Worldwide Group Holdings Limited ("Ascend"). Ascend will be integrated with RBI's aerospace information and data services business, Flightglobal.
Ascend, headquartered in London with offices in New York, Hong Kong and Tokyo, delivers aircraft and engine data through online subscription services and provides valuations, appraisals and advisory services to a world-wide client base spanning aviation investors and financiers, lessors, manufacturers, operators and suppliers. Ascend plays a key role in informing decisions and identifying opportunities within the aviation industry.
RBI's Flightglobal provides aerospace information and data services through http://www.flightglobal.com (the largest professional aviation website in the world), Flight International and Airline Business magazines, civil fleet data fromACAS, and real time news and business intelligence from Air Transport Intelligence.
"Ascend brings to Flightglobal an impressive position in the global air finance market," says Jane Burgess, RBI managing director. "This exciting acquisition adds important new data assets and expertise to Flightglobal's existing aviation data business and provides Ascend with access to Flightglobal's powerful global aviation audience and extensive marketing capabilities."
"I am very excited about the opportunities that the combination of Ascend and Flightglobal will bring." says Gehan Talwatte, Ascend CEO. "By combining our insight and expertise with Flightglobal's growing global audience, distribution capabilities and unrivalled media presence, we can significantly extend the reach of the Ascend brand."

About Ascend Worldwide Group Holdings Limited
Ascend (http://www.ascendworldwide.com) is one of the world's principal providers of data, analytics and advisory services to investors in aerospace. Its global team advises on aviation investment strategies to maximise returns and generate proven investment results. For over four decades, Ascend has supplied the most reliable, trusted and up-to-date aviation industry information and insight available anywhere.
Offerings include: aviation data; aircraft and engine valuations and appraisals; and advisory services. From financiers and lessors to aircraft manufacturers, operators and suppliers, the aviation industry relies on Ascend to help make informed decisions and capture new opportunities.
